		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="#comment-247253"><em>Hugh @ 223</em></a></p>
<blockquote><p>Cozumel</p>
<p>The AUMF for Iraq was voted on October 11, 2002.</p>
<p>The operative paragraph is:</p>
<blockquote><p>SEC. 3. AUTHORIZATION FOR USE OF UNITED STATES ARMED FORCES.<br />
(a) AUTHORIZATION- The President is authorized to use the Armed Forces of the United States as he determines to be necessary and appropriate in order to–<br />
(1) defend the national security of the United States against the continuing threat posed by Iraq; and<br />
(2) enforce all relevant United Nations Security Council resolutions regarding Iraq.</p>
</blockquote>
<p>It does not specifically call for a land invasion.</p>
</blockquote>
<p>That’s not what Gerstein got wrong.  He apparently told Tweety the resolution calling for regime change back in 1998 — when Clinton was President — authorized the invasion.  When Tweety asked Ned about that, Ned correctly said that resolution authorized aid to dissident Iraqui groups — hello, Chalabi, this one’s for you — not invasion.</p>
